Other Options for Users- (Do Not Track Disclosure)

Do Not Track (also refers to as 'DNT') is a privacy preference that users and members can set in their web browsers. This allows users and members to inform websites and services that they do not want certain information about their webpage visits collected over time and across websites or online services.

We are always committed to provide our users with meaningful choices about the information that we collect. In this regard, this is the reason why we provide the opt-out option in this Privacy Policy. However, we do not recognize or respond to any DNT signals as the Internet industry works toward defining exactly what DNT means, what it means to comply with DNT, and a common approach to responding to DNT.

Information on Cookies

A cookie is a small text file that is stored on a user's device for record keeping purposes. Cookies come in two types; session cookies or persistent cookies. A session cookie expires when you close your browser and is used to make it easier for you to navigate the site. A persistent cookie on the other hand remains on your device for an extended period of time. Cookies on our site do not link to or store your personal information.

Web Beacons

Web beacons that are also referred to as clear gifs, pixel tags or web bugs are tiny graphics with a unique identifier, similar in function to cookies, and are used to track the online movements of web users or to access cookies. Web beacons are embedded invisibly on the web pages and in emails.

Web beacons may be used to deliver or communicate with cookies, to count users who have visited certain pages and to understand usage patterns.
